How Long Do Hearing Aids Last?

Typically, hearing aids last between 3 to 7 years, but it depends on various factors including maintenance, usage, and technological advancements. While high-quality brands like Signia, Phonak, Widex, ReSound, and Oticon offer robust devices, even the best ones eventually require replacement.

Signs that It’s Time to Replace Hearing Aids

Recognizing the signs indicating when to replace your hearing aids is crucial for ensuring they serve you well. Here are the key indicators:

1. Outdated Technology

Technology in hearing aids evolves rapidly, much like smartphones or computers. If your device is over five years old, there's a chance you're missing out on significant advancements that could enhance your hearing experience.

2. Noticeable Decrease in Performance

If you notice a consistent decline in sound quality, difficulty in hearing clearly, or increased feedback, it might be time to consider a hearing aid upgrade. These changes are often subtle and can gradually worsen, impacting your daily life.

3. Physical Wear and Tear

Regular use can lead to the physical degradation of your hearing aids. Cracks, broken components, or persistent battery issues are signs that it's time to replace hearing aids.

4. Changes in Hearing Ability

Your hearing needs might change over time due to age, health conditions, or other factors. If your current hearing aids no longer meet your needs, it’s wise to seek a model that can be better customized to your current level of hearing.

5. Lifestyle Changes

New job or lifestyle changes can require different features from your hearing aids such as improved connectivity, better moisture resistance, or enhanced noise cancellation features available in latest models.

Benefits of a Hearing Aid Upgrade

  • Improved Sound Quality: Newer models offer enhanced sound clarity and reduced feedback.
  • Advanced Features: Modern hearing aids come with Bluetooth connectivity, smartphone app integrations, and remote controls.
  • Better Battery Life: Upgraded designs offer longer-lasting batteries, reducing the need for frequent changes.
  • Increased Comfort: Sleeker designs provide a more comfortable and discreet hearing solution.

Upgrading your hearing aids means accessing cutting-edge technology and improved functionalities, enhancing overall user satisfaction.

Frequently Asked Questions

Q1: How often should hearing aids be replaced?

A hearing aid upgrade is typically recommended every 5 years to ensure the best performance and access to the latest technologies.

Q2: Can hearing aid upgrades improve sound quality?

Yes, newer models offer improved sound clarity, reduced feedback, and advanced features not available in older versions.

Q3: What are the signs that my hearing aids need replacing?

Signs include decreased performance, visible wear and tear, outdated technology, or changes in your hearing ability.

Q4: Do I need new hearing aids if my lifestyle changes?

Possibly, as lifestyle changes might necessitate advanced features like better moisture resistance or connectivity options available in newer hearing aids.
